This book, written in the midst of the turmoil of the Napoleonic Wars, persuasively argues against the alarmism surrounding Great Britain's financial and military state. The author deftly employs lucid economic principles, historical examples, and biting wit to demonstrate the inherent strength of the British economy and the absurdity of fears surrounding a French invasion. Drawing from Britain's long and successful history of self-defense, the author emboldens readers to not only reject the defeatist rhetoric of the day but to confront the threat with resilience and determination. Through an incisive analysis of the nature of wealth, taxation, and the limits of state power, this book provides a vital historical perspective on themes that remain relevant to this day.
